OK so I was down at our new KTM dealer in town and the tech mentioned he just got back from the LC8 school at KTM USA and could get a custom tune for any pipe. So when I put my leo vince pipes on sure enough there was a dead spot so I gave it to the dealer...one day later and holy crap what a difference! I don't know what they did but I can tell the torque limiter is gone for gears 1 and 2, there is more power, and it is much smoother than stock with no fueling issues whatsoever. Only mods are leo vince pipes and SAS removal. I imagine any of the aftermarket tuning devices would have worked just as well (or better perhaps) but why bother when the dealer can do it pretty inexpensively and will take responsibility for any negative side effects.

So the moral of the story is...anyone who hasn't gotten a tune....get one!

And according to my dealer there is only one Akra map as such. Yeah there is one for the different years but not one for different exhaust systems. Doesn't matter if you have slip-ons from Akra or full system it's still the same map.
